AI agents and automation platforms represent the cutting edge of AI — autonomous systems that can execute multi-step tasks, make decisions, and interact with external tools and APIs. The market is nascent but rapidly evolving, with use cases spanning customer service, sales outreach, and software development.
Enterprise spending on AI agents grew 500% in 2026, though 60% of deployments are still in pilot phase. The most successful implementations start with narrow, well-defined tasks rather than broad autonomous mandates.
Start with the simplest agent that solves one specific problem well. Autonomous agents that try to do everything often fail at everything. Pick a single high-value, repetitive task and automate that first.
